Bean Stew with Sour Beans

The perfect bean stew with sour beans recipe with a picture and simple step-by-step instructions.

  • 1 Onion
  • 600 g Potatoes
  • 250 ml Vegetable broth
  • 3 Mettenden
  • 400 g Sour BeansTK
  • Salt
  • Pepper
  • 400 g Beans yellow
  • 1 Onion
  • Salt
  • Pepper
  • Vinegar
  • Oil
  1. ******************************* SOUR BEANS *************** ********************
  2. Put the beans in a saucepan with waaser, peel the onion, add quarters, season salt and pepper and simmer on the stove.
  3. Remove the pan from the heat and season the beans vigorously with vinegar and a little oil – set aside
  4. Peel the potatoes and cut into cubes, finely chop the peeled onion and sauté in a saucepan with a little oil.
  5. Drain the beans and add them to the pot with the potatoes, pour in the vegetable stock until the stew is covered and simmer for 10-20 minutes.
  6. Add minced meatballs to the stew, season with salt and pepper and heat until the sausages get hot.
